Plumber Services in Pretoria, Gauteng
In Pretoria, Gauteng, plumbing services cover a broad spectrum of domestic and small-scale commercial needs. Local plumbers are typically called upon for maintenance, repairs, and installations across kitchens, bathrooms, and utility rooms. The emphasis is on reliable, practical solutions that minimise disruption to daily life and safeguard water and energy usage in a climate marked by seasonal fluctuations.
Typical services fall into several broad categories. Cold-water and hot-water systems are a common focus, with expert attention given to leak detection, pipe repairs, and the replacement of ageing copper or plastic piping. Water heater installations and servicing are frequently requested, including point-of-use systems, solar-compatible setups, and efficient storage solutions designed to balance supply with demand. Drainage and waste systems form another core area, covering unblocking blocked drains, clearing sewer lines, and ensuring correct slope and venting to prevent odours and backups.
Bathroom and kitchen installations feature prominently. Plumbers are often engaged for emergency fixes such as burst pipes or dripping taps, as well as for more planned projects like replacing toilets, installing mixers, and fitting additional basins or bidets. In Pretoria’s varied housing stock, including older homes and newer townhouses, plumbers adapt techniques to suit different layouts, space constraints, and existing fixtures. In many instances, this involves recalibrating water pressure, installing regulators where necessary, and upgrading piping to reduce noise and improve efficiency.
Ventilation and energy efficiency are increasingly important considerations. Where appropriate, professionals assess hot water requirements, recommend insulated pipework, and explore options for temperature control and water-saving devices. Electric immersion heaters and more modern chauffeured heating solutions may be discussed, subject to building regulations and electrical compatibility. On the regulatory front, the focus remains on safe installation practices and compliance with local municipal guidelines, without presuming specific certification schemes or platforms.
Plumbers often provide maintenance packages designed to prevent small problems from becoming costly disruptions. Routine inspections may cover pressure testing, leak checks behind walls, and the condition of seals and joints in vulnerable areas such as bathrooms and outdoor taps. Regular maintenance can extend the life of fixtures and reduce water wastage, a practical benefit in a region where water conservation is a common consideration.
Customers can expect a pragmatic approach to workmanship. Most services begin with a consultation to understand the issue, followed by a visible assessment or diagnostic work, and then a quoted plan outlining materials, labour, and a timeline. The workflow typically culminates in a completion note, with advice on ongoing care and any preventative steps. In urgent cases, response times vary by location, traffic, and scheduling, but the priority remains to restore functionality with minimal inconvenience.
Practical considerations for engaging a plumber in Pretoria include arranging access to running water and electricity for certain tasks, clarifying preferred payment methods, and confirming whether the job may affect neighbouring units. Homeowners and managers alike benefit from seeking clear explanations of recommended fixes, expected durability, and any seasonal contingencies, especially during colder months when heating and hot-water systems are scrutinised more closely.
Overall, Pretoria’s plumbing landscape reflects a mix of standard household maintenance and targeted installations tailored to local housing styles and environmental conditions. Prospective clients are advised to request a detailed written plan, compare multiple quotes where possible, and assess the plumber’s approach to safety, efficiency, and long-term reliability.
